not for glory is a restless, relentless, rebellious unravelling of traditional dance and music. It is not a radical Highland Dance show, not a reinvented Irish dance display and not an experimental piping competition. Its bodies, bagpipes and brutality. It’s kilts, queerness and ceremonial violence. It’s back beats, high cuts, striking in, a battering, flinging skirl.

not for glory resuscitates tradition with respect and resilience, dissects heritage and dances solidarity. It’s a dance-theatre gig balancing virtuosity with vulnerability, pride with shame. Three performers reclaim the traditions they grew up in, not for glory - but for what?
